MLB The Show 16 Instant Replay Challenge System Remains Unchanged From Last Year
For those of you hoping for more variety and options for the Instant Replay Challenge System in MLB The Show 16, the team mentioned on Twitter, that the plays that can be challenged are the same as last year. Which means, certain close plays at first base can be challenged by the user, home runs will once again be challenged automatically.
